Output e1ba56c4eec1a98c8dc4e226985f23947dc737ad85d2546189c2c393633c6817: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1b0f7029c362a3e45aa5e72fbf1a22140ec4944 OP_EQUAL
address
3HtZXEVSL3zrSb4ccYdkyYhEJy3ezZF7rd
transaction
e1ba56c4eec1a98c8dc4e226985f23947dc737ad85d2546189c2c393633c6817
spent
true